Let $mathbf{c}_0$ be the real vector space of all real sequences which converge to zero. For every $x,yin mathbf{c}_0$, it is said that $y$ is block diagonal majorized by $x$ (written $yprec_b x$) if there exists a block diagonal row stochastic matrix $R$ such that $y=Rx$. In this paper we find the possible structure of linear functions $T:mathbf{c}_0rightarrow mathbf{c}_0$ preserving $prec_b$.

Journal: :Computational Statistics & Data Analysis 2006
Xiao-Wen Chang

Huber’s M-estimation technique is applied to a block-angular regression problem, which may arise from some applications. A recursive, modified Newton approach to computing the estimates is presented. The structure of the problem is exploited to make the algorithm efficient.
